Hey, welcome aboard. This ticket covers the Maplight tile cache dropping rendered tiles at zoom 14+ under load. We think eviction is keying on the wrong hash field, so hot tiles get tossed first. Repro steps are in the linked doc; the staging cluster in Fernrow is yours to abuse. Once you can reproduce it, grab the failing render job's trace token and drop it below.

pipeline stamp: htk9_ce63042d9

Welcome to the Soundrill team. The waveform preview you'll work on is generated server-side by the Ampler service, which downsamples uploads to 1,000 peak pairs and caches them as JSON blobs. The player widget in Clipdeck renders these on canvas; never decode audio in the browser. Regeneration happens automatically when a file is re-uploaded. Specs, rendering conventions, and the cache invalidation rules are all documented on this internal page.

wiki page, tahaf-tajog: https://jira.ordindyn.corp/pipeline

**Ticket LC-742 — Catalogue import accepts unvalidated MARC blobs**

The Thornquay library catalogue importer parses uploaded record batches before checking the signature manifest, meaning a crafted blob reaches the XML parser pre-verification. No exploitation observed, but this inverts our trust boundary. Fix reorders validation ahead of parsing and adds size caps. Please review the patched importer built under the token below.

build token for yajof-bajof: htk31_506ff1188f74596b5bb2eec94edc43c